Admission Requirements

Program Eligibility Requirements

  1. High School Diploma
  2. High School GPA of 3.0 or higher at time of application
  3. If available, Minimum ACT Composite Score of 22; English of 21; Math of 22; and Science of 22 at time of application
  4. Admitted to UW-Green Bay
  5. 15 or fewer university degree credits post high school

Preferred Eligibility Criteria

  • High School science courses such as Biology, Chemistry or Anatomy & Physiology with a grade of B or better (minimum of three)
  • High School math courses including Algebra, Geometry and Advanced Algebra with a grade of B or better to demonstrate
    preparedness for college math
  • Completion of a Wisconsin Department of Health Services (DHS) approved Nursing Assistant course
    Required prior to Year 2
  • Related volunteer or healthcare work experiences
  • Ability to speak a language other than English

Application Process

  • Apply to UW-Green Bay as a pre-nursing student at https://apply.wisconsin.edu/
  • Complete the NURSE 1-2-1 Application Form using your UW-Green Bay student username, password, and ID number.
  • Applicants who submit the Nurse 1-2-1 application by January 1st will be notified of the admission decision by January 15th. Applications received after January 1st will be reviewed as space allows.
